Can you have 2 Snapchat accounts with the same email?

One is able to use the same number for more than one Snapchat account, yes, but only the most recent account will have that number listed in Settings, and can use the “Friend Finder” feature. Only one email can be used per Snapchat account, however.

Can I get my Snapchat back after 30 days of deleting it?

At any time in the 30 days, if you want to restore your Snapchat account, just log in to it through the Smartphone app. You’ll be asked if you want to reactivate your account. If your Snapchat account gets permanently deleted, it’s gone. There is no recovery.

Will someone know if I log into their Snapchat?

The answer is yes. If you log in to someone’s Snapchat account on another device it will kick them out of Snapchat on their device. While they may not know the exact person that signed in they will know someone else is using their Snapchat account on another iPhone, Android, iPod or iPad.

How do you know if someone is inactive on Snapchat?

Snapchat uses icons to show you the status of anything you send. If the notification says ‘delivered’ but not ‘opened,’ the recipient is either offline or hasn’t opened the Snap. If it says ‘opened,’ then you know the person is either online or was recently active.

Can police see Snapchats?

As a U.S. company, Snap requires U.S. law enforcement and governmental agencies to follow U.S. law in order for Snap to disclose any Snapchat account records. Our ability to disclose Snapchat account records is generally governed by the Stored Communications Act, 18 U.S.C. § 2701, et seq.
